Steering Column Trim Covers - Disassemble - Off Vehicle (Column Shift)

Tools Required: J 41352 Modular Column Holding Fixture
NOTE:
Place the steering column in the CENTER position.
- Put the steering column and J 41352 into a vise.
- Inspect the steering column for accident damage. Refer to Steering Column Accident Damage Inspection - Off Vehicle .
- Remove the tilt knob from the lower trim cover.
- Remove the 2 pan head tapping screws (1) from the lower trim cover (2).
- Remove the lower trim cover from the upper trim cover.
- Tilt the lower trim cover down.
- Slide the lower trim cover backward in order to disengage the locking tabs.
- Remove the trim cover protector (1) from the lower trim cover (2).
- Slide the shift lever seal (2) up the shift lever (4). Remove the shift lever screw (3).
- Remove the shift lever assembly (4) from the upper trim cover (1).
- Remove the shift lever seal (2) from the shift lever assembly (4).
- Remove the 2 TORX® head screws (1) from the upper trim cover (2).
- Remove the upper trim cover (2) from the steering column.
